The aim of this article is to extend linear quantum dynamical network theory to include static Bogoliubov components (such as squeezers). Within this integrated quantum network theory, we provide general methods for cascade or series connections, as well as feedback interconnections using linear fractional transformations. In addition, we define input-output maps and transfer functions for representing components and describing convergence. We also discuss the underlying group structure in this theory arising from series interconnection. Several examples illustrate the theory.
